Form Guide — Last 5

Independiente

LWDLW

Independiente’s recent five results include a 3‑1 away win over Lanus and a 1‑0 away win against Central Cordoba, showing they can score and hold a lead. Conversely, the 0‑3 home loss to Gimnasia M. highlights vulnerability, but the two wins give the model confidence in a home victory for this pick.

San Lorenzo

LWDLW

San Lorenzo’s last five feature a 1‑0 home win over Union Santa Fe and a 1‑0 home win over Talleres Cordoba, proving they can secure narrow wins. However, the 0‑2 home defeat to Huracan and a 0‑1 away loss to Instituto underscore limited scoring ability, supporting the view they are unlikely to overturn Independiente’s edge.

Head-to-Head

In the five recent meetings, Independiente have won twice (both 2‑1) and drawn three times, with no losses, confirming a historical edge that aligns with the model’s win probability.
